About Boom Supersonic

Boom Supersonic, founded in 2014, is on a mission to revolutionize the aviation industry with its cutting-edge commercial airliner, Overture. Emphasizing their slogan, "Building the world's fastest airliner, Overture — optimized for speed, safety, and sustainability," the company envisions bringing people worldwide closer through enhanced supersonic travel. Headquartered in the United States, Boom Supersonic operates at the intersection of the Manufacturing, Space, and Transportation sectors.

With a robust team of over 150 employees, the company garners significant expertise, having contributed to over 220 air and spacecraft programs. Their commitment to industry-leading standards ensures that Boom stands out in the aerospace arena. The company recently secured a substantial $300.00M late VC investment from Darsana Capital Partners in December 2025, underscoring investor confidence in its vision and potential to transform air travel.
